Output c7e160cb2881727679b4ef9822cb617004fe9930df1596c7e2b2c55d44d04257:1

value
1020520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eef05e82baac46935c4c211a83328b21098dbbee OP_EQUAL
address
3PUQhLqzvH9MMuLJuKRgxpVHNSFoonW6jZ
transaction
c7e160cb2881727679b4ef9822cb617004fe9930df1596c7e2b2c55d44d04257
confirmations
390161
spent
true